WebA fracture of the calcaneus, or heel bone, can be a painful and disabling injury. This type of fracture commonly occurs during a high-energy event — such as a car crash or a fall from a ladder — when the heel is crushed under the weight of the body. When this occurs, the heel can widen, shorten, and become deformed. WebFeb 13, 2024 · Bone Repair: Step 2. Over the next 4-21 days, you get a soft callus around the broken bone. Definitely: There are quite a few subtle fractures of the hand that can be easily missed on the first round of X Rays. it is only when X … WebAug 11, 2024 · Bone infection. If a part of your broken bone protrudes through your skin, it can be exposed to germs that can cause infection. Prompt treatment of this type of fracture is critical.
